This typeface is a high-contrast serif with an emphatic vertical rhythm and crisp, hairline serifs. Stems are thick and dark while connecting strokes and terminals drop to very fine lines, producing a distinctly engraved, poster-ready texture. Serifs are sharp and mostly unbracketed, with pointed beaks and tapered endings that add bite to the silhouettes. Round letters show a clear vertical stress and tight apertures, and the overall letterforms feel slightly expanded, giving capitals a stately, billboard-like presence.

In text, the heavy verticals create strong word shapes and a dense color, while the hairlines and sharp terminals add sparkle and detail at larger sizes. The numerals and uppercase are especially commanding, and the design’s crisp joins and tapered strokes emphasize a refined, print-oriented aesthetic.
